What is a Moodle Developer job?

A Moodle Developer is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ining e-learning platforms using Moodle, an open-source Learning Management System (LMS). They create custom plugins, themes, and integrations to enhance Moodle’s functionality, ensuring it meets the needs of educators and learners. This role involves troubleshooting issues, optimizing performance, and ensuring compliance with accessibility and security standards. Moodle Developers typically work with PHP, MySQL, JavaScript, and related technologies to customize and extend the platform’s capabilities.

What coding language is Moodle?

Moodle is primarily developed using PHP, a server-side scripting language. Developers working on Moodle often also use JavaScript, HTML, and CSS for customizing themes and user interfaces. Knowledge of SQL is useful for managing databases associated with Moodle installations.

What is a Moodle developer?

A Moodle developer is a professional who designs, customizes, and maintains the Moodle learning management system, often using PHP, HTML, and JavaScript. They may also troubleshoot issues, develop plugins, and ensure the platform meets educational or organizational needs.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Moodle Developer?

A typical day for a Moodle Developer involves developing and customizing plugins and themes, troubleshooting issues, and implementing updates to enhance system performance and security. You might work closely with instructional designers, educators, and IT teams to translate learning needs into technical solutions within the Moodle platform. Regular tasks often include code reviews, database management, and integrating third-party tools to extend Moodle’s functionality. Collaboration and ongoing communication are key, as you’ll frequently participate in meetings to prioritize features and address stakeholder feedback.
